E27.0 Other adrenocortical overactivity
The ICD-10-CM code for Other adrenocortical overactivity is E27.0 (FY2026). It is a billable, claim-ready diagnosis code.

Also Known As
ICD-10-CM Alphabetic Index entries that lead to E27.0:
- Adrenarche, premature
- Slocumb's syndrome
- Schroeder's syndrome (endocrine hypertensive)
- Hypersecretion › ACTH (not associated with Cushing's syndrome)
- Dysadrenocortism › hyperfunction
- Hyperfunction › adrenal cortex, not associated with Cushing's syndrome
- Hyperadrenocorticism › not associated with Cushing's syndrome
- Overactive › adrenal cortex NEC
Inclusion Terms
- Overproduction of ACTH, not associated with Cushing's disease
- Premature adrenarche
U.S. Hospital Utilization
- An estimated 505 U.S. inpatient stays in 2023 included E27.0 among the documented diagnoses.
Source: National Inpatient Sample (NIS), Healthcare Cost and Utilization Project (HCUP),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ality, 2016–2023. National survey-weighted estimates.
